KOTTAYAM: The saline water intrusion into the Vembanad lake from the sea has increased posing a threat to the paddy crops of Kuttanad. The Thanneermukkam bund constructed in 1975 and the 'Orumuttus' (earthen bunds) have failed to protect the crops from salinity. The salinity level has increased in the outer portion of Vembanad lake, including the northern side at Vaikom, pointing to the disastrous effect of climate change. The crop may get destroyed if the salinity level is more than 2 PPT (a measurement to detect the presence of salt in one kilogram of water).
